<p><P>PROBLEM TO BE SOLVED: To provide a noninvasive blood pressure monitoring apparatus capable of consecutively estimating a change in blood pressures of a subject without making a dialysis patient feel discomfort. <P>SOLUTION: For solving the problem, this blood pressure monitoring apparatus includes: a light source; a first drive circuit for actuating the light source; a detector having sensitivity to the wavelength of a light emitted from the light source; a second drive circuit for actuating the detector; a retaining member retaining the light source and the detector at prescribed optical axial angles; a processing section for extracting a pulse wave signal from an output signal of the detector; and a blood pressure change estimation section where the extracted pulse wave signal is input. The blood pressure change estimation section differentiates the pulse wave signal twice and derives the change in the blood pressures based on a time change in the pulse wave signal processed by the second-order differential equation. <P>COPYRIGHT: (C)2011,JPO&INPIT</p> |
